What that tells you if that Moorhead was so bad he couldn’t stay mediocre with a talented MSU team. Mullen was brilliant at finding under the radar and risk guys and developing them. It also tells you that was bad as Moorhead was he couldn’t hold a candle to Willie’s crap.


No, I get a different reading. 1) MSU actually had more talent on its roster than FSU had in Joe and Willie's 2 year tenures at MSU and FSU, respectively. 2) Both coaches got fired after 2 years so that is a wash, 3) Jimbo in his last year went 7-6 at FSU that is the ACC we are talking about. FSU went 10-3 in 2016 which is a solid record. So the slide that FSU had under Willie started with Jimbo in 2017 and the majority of the roster on the 2018 and all of the upperclassmen on both 2018 and 2019 are Jimbo's recruits, which have not produced the amount of NFL draft picks that MSU has, as I already documented.

So Jimbo's resume trajectory has not been on an upward trend looking at his recruiting at FSU (and record their last year) and his first 2 years in the SEC at the Aggies.

Maybe this year he will start an upward trajectory. But what type of record really signifies upward trajectory. Last 3 years 2017-FSU, 7-6, 2018 Aggies 9-4, 2019-Aggies 8-5. So if Texas A&M goes 9-3 this year, is that really enough since he is getting guaranteed $75 million. Even with a bowl win to get to 10-3, that would be a 4-year aggregate record of 34-18. So does 10-3 really do enough to move the trajectory of Jimbo's coaching performance upward. I mean lets look at more, Jimbo can go 9-3 next year and the only difference is the schedule was much easier. If you loose to Bama and Auburn on the road, and loose another game somewhere like LSU, SCAR, one of the MS schools, etc, yes you are 9-3, but does that suggest you are still ready to win the West. To win the West, you (Aggie) have to have a team that can beat Bama, Auburn and LSU in the same season. I still don't think A&M can do that, if you all do it, I will say congrats job well done. Until then, well it is all noise.
